CD PROJEKT RED has announced Songs of the Past, a surprise third expansion for its critically acclaimed role-playing game, The Witcher 3: Wild Hunt. The studio is co-developing the project with Fool’s Theory, a team composed of industry veterans who previously worked on the original game.

Scheduled to launch in 2027 for PlayStation 5, Xbox Series X|S, and PC, the expansion will return players to the boots of legendary monster slayer Geralt of Rivia for a brand-new adventure.
Since its initial release in 2015, The Witcher 3 has sold over 60 million copies and secured more than 250 Game of the Year awards. While specific plot details remain under wraps, CD PROJEKT RED has confirmed that more information regarding Songs of the Past will be shared in late summer 2026.
To support the upcoming content, the system requirements for both The Witcher 3: Wild Hunt and Songs of the Past are being updated to ensure optimal performance and compatibility moving forward.
